Especificações

Atributo Valor
Package Tray
Series STM32L4
ProductStatus Active
CoreProcessor ARM® Cortex®-M4
CoreSize 32-Bit Single-Core
Speed 80MHz
Connectivity I²C, Infrared, IrDA, LINbus, Quad SPI, SPI, UART/USART, USB
Peripherals Brown-out Detect/Reset, DMA, PWM, WDT
NumberofI/O 52
ProgramMemorySize 128KB (128K x 8)
ProgramMemoryType FLASH
RAMSize 40K x 8
Voltage-Supply(Vcc/Vdd) 1.71V ~ 3.6V
DataConverters A/D 16x12b
OscillatorType Internal
OperatingTemperature -40°C ~ 85°C (TA)
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case 64-LQFP

Description

The STM32L412RBT6 is a microcontroller from STMicroelectronics, part of the STM32L4 series known for ultra-low-power performance. It features an Arm Cortex-M4 core with a floating-point unit, operating at up to 80 MHz. The microcontroller offers 128 KB of Flash memory and 40 KB of SRAM, making it suitable for applications requiring moderate memory resources. It includes a variety of peripherals such as multiple GPIOs, USART, I2C, SPI interfaces, and a 12-bit ADC, which are useful for communication and sensor interfacing.
The STM32L412RBT6 is designed for low-power applications, featuring several power-saving modes. It supports a wide range of power supply voltages from 1.71 to 3.6V and offers dynamic voltage scaling, enabling optimized power consumption. Its low-power capabilities make it ideal for battery-operated devices, wearables, and IoT applications. The microcontroller is available in an LQFP-64 package.
For development, STMicroelectronics provides a comprehensive ecosystem, including the STM32CubeMX for configuration and STM32CubeIDE for development, offering extensive libraries and resources.
